%% @doc This module contains functions these are responsible for parsing binary rows that was previously
%% exctructed from response packages. The module works only with binary rows these usualy come in to
%% a client during a statement execution.
-module(packet_parser_binary).
%%
%% Include files
%%
-include("client_records.hrl").
-include("mysql_types.hrl").
%%
%% Import modules
%%
-import(lists, [reverse/1]).
-import(helper_common, []).
%%
%% Exported Functions
%%
-export([parse_binary_row/2]).
%%
%% API Functions
%%
-spec parse_binary_row(Binary::binary(), Metadata::#metadata{}) -> list(integer() | float() | string() | binary() | #mysql_time{} | #mysql_decimal{}) | #mysql_error{}.
%% @spec parse_binary_row(Binary::binary(), Metadata::#metadata{}) -> list(integer() | float() | string() | binary() | #mysql_time{} | #mysql_decimal{}) | #mysql_error{}
%% @doc function converts binary representation of a packet to list of field values.
%% First it extracts 'Null bit map' structure from binary. The map keeps information
%% about what fields of the response is NULL
%% (if a field is NULL the one is not present in the next part of the binary packet).
%%
parse_binary_row(B, #metadata{field_count = N} = Metadata) ->
Bitmap_size = ((N + 9) div 8),
<<Null_bitmap:Bitmap_size/bytes, B1/binary>> = B,
Bit_size = Bitmap_size * 8 - 2,
<<NULL_bit_map:Bit_size/bits, _:2>> = helper_common:reverse_binary(Null_bitmap),
case Data = loop_binary_row(B1, Metadata#metadata.field_metadata, NULL_bit_map, []) of
#mysql_error{} -> Data;
_ -> Data
end.
%%
%% Local Functions
%%
-spec loop_binary_row(Binary::binary(), Field_metadata_list::list(), NULL_bit_map::binary(), ValueList::list()) -> list() | #mysql_error{}.
%% @spec loop_binary_row(Binary::binary(), Field_metadata_list::list(), NULL_bit_map::binary(), ValueList::list()) -> list() | #mysql_error{}
%% @doc Converts Binary (row of query result set) to list of field values according by field metadata information stored in Field_metadata_list and NULL_bit_map.
%% Returns list of formatted field values. Note that processing of NULL fields is skiped.
loop_binary_row(Empty, [], _, Result) ->
if
size(Empty) =:= 0 -> reverse(Result);
true ->
#mysql_error{type = connection, message = "Packet format is wrong",
source = "loop_binary_row(E, [], _, Result)"}
end;
loop_binary_row(B, [Field_metadata | Metadata], NULL_bit_map_param, Result) ->
Bit_map_size = bit_size(NULL_bit_map_param) - 1,
<<NULL_bit_map:Bit_map_size/bits, Bit:1/integer>> = NULL_bit_map_param,
if
Bit =:= 1 ->
loop_binary_row(B, Metadata, NULL_bit_map, [null | Result]);
true ->
Flags = helper_common:parse_data_flags(Field_metadata#field_metadata.flags),
Is_binary = lists:member(binary, Flags),
Is_enum = lists:member(enum, Flags),
Is_set = lists:member(set, Flags),
Is_unsigned = lists:member(unsigned, Flags),
{Value, B1} = draw_value(B, Field_metadata, {Is_binary, Is_enum, Is_set, Is_unsigned}),
loop_binary_row(B1, Metadata, NULL_bit_map, [Value | Result])
end.
%% @spec draw_value(B::binary, Field_metadata::#field_metadata{}, Flags::list()) -> {Value, Rest::binary()}
%% @throws nothing
%% @doc Extracts a field value from binary stream. Returns tuple of the field value and a rest of binary stream.
%%
draw_value(B, #field_metadata{type = ?MYSQL_TYPE_FLOAT}, _Flags) ->
<<Value:32/little-float, B1/binary>> = B,
{Value, B1};
draw_value(B, #field_metadata{type = ?MYSQL_TYPE_DOUBLE}, _Flags) ->
<<Value:64/little-float, B1/binary>> = B,
{Value, B1};
draw_value(B, #field_metadata{type = ?MYSQL_TYPE_TIMESTAMP}, _Flags) ->
helper_common:binary_to_datetime(B);
draw_value(B, #field_metadata{type = ?MYSQL_TYPE_DATE}, _Flags) ->
<<Field_size:8/integer, V0:Field_size/binary, B1/binary>> = B,
case V0 of
<<>> ->
{#mysql_time{year = 0, month = 0, day = 0}, B1};
_ ->
<<Year:16/little-integer, Month:8/integer, Day:8/integer>> = V0,
{#mysql_time{year = Year, month = Month, day = Day}, B1}
end;
draw_value(B, #field_metadata{type = ?MYSQL_TYPE_TIME}, _Flags) ->
<<Field_size:8/integer, V0:Field_size/binary, B1/binary>> = B,
<<Negative:8/integer, Day:32/little-integer,
Hour:8/integer, Minute:8/integer, Second:8/integer, Sec_part/binary>> = V0,
Second_part =
case Sec_part of
<<>> -> 0;
<<Sec_part_int:32/little-integer>> -> Sec_part_int
end,
{#mysql_time{neg = (Negative =/= 0), hour = Hour + Day * 24, minute = Minute,
second = Second, second_part = Second_part}, B1};
draw_value(B, #field_metadata{type = ?MYSQL_TYPE_DATETIME}, _Flags) ->
helper_common:binary_to_datetime(B);
draw_value(B, #field_metadata{type = ?MYSQL_TYPE_YEAR}, _Flags) ->
<<Value:16/little-integer, B1/binary>> = B,
{Value, B1};
draw_value(B, #field_metadata{type = ?MYSQL_TYPE_VARCHAR}, _Flags) ->
helper_common:extract_length_coded(false, B);
draw_value(B, #field_metadata{type = ?MYSQL_TYPE_BIT, length = Value_size}, _Flags) ->
<<Field_size:8/integer, V:Field_size/binary, B1/binary>> = B,
BitSize = Field_size * 8 - Value_size,
<<0:BitSize, Value:Value_size/bitstring>> = V,
{Value, B1};
draw_value(B, #field_metadata{type = ?MYSQL_TYPE_NEWDECIMAL}, _Flags) ->
{String, B1} = helper_common:extract_length_coded(false, B),
case string:tokens(String, ".") of
[Int, Fract] -> {#mysql_decimal{int = Int, fraction = Fract}, B1};
[Int] -> {#mysql_decimal{int = Int}, B1};
_ -> {#mysql_decimal{}, B1}
end;
draw_value(B, #field_metadata{type = ?MYSQL_TYPE_BLOB}, {Is_binary, _, _, _}) ->
helper_common:extract_length_coded(Is_binary, B);
draw_value(B, #field_metadata{type = ?MYSQL_TYPE_VAR_STRING}, {Is_binary, _, _, _}) ->
helper_common:extract_length_coded(Is_binary, B);
draw_value(B, #field_metadata{type = ?MYSQL_TYPE_STRING}, {Is_binary, Is_enum, Is_set, _}) ->
if
Is_binary -> helper_common:extract_length_coded(true, B);
Is_enum ->
{String, B1} = helper_common:extract_length_coded(false, B),
{list_to_atom(String), B1};
Is_set ->
{String, B1} = helper_common:extract_length_coded(false, B),
{lists:map(fun(A) -> list_to_atom(A) end, string:tokens(String, ",")), B1};
true -> helper_common:extract_length_coded(false, B)
end;
draw_value(B, Field_metadata, {_, _, _, Is_unsigned}) ->
Int_length = case Field_metadata#field_metadata.type of
?MYSQL_TYPE_TINY -> 8;
?MYSQL_TYPE_SHORT -> 16;
?MYSQL_TYPE_LONG -> 32;
?MYSQL_TYPE_LONGLONG -> 64;
?MYSQL_TYPE_INT24 -> 32
end,
draw_integer_value(B, Is_unsigned, Int_length).
%% @spec draw_integer_value(B::binary(), Is_unsigned::boolean(), Int_length::integer()) -> {Value, Rest::binary()}
%% @doc Extracts integer value from binary.
%%
draw_integer_value(B, true, Int_length) ->
<<Value:Int_length/little-integer, B1/binary>> = B,
{Value, B1};
draw_integer_value(B, false, Int_length) ->
<<Value:Int_length/signed-little-integer, B1/binary>> = B,
{Value, B1}.
